Περιγραφή:We study the ICT adoption and use in Costa Rican export companies based on the results of a field survey. The e-commerce readiness/intensity/ impact model, developed by the Organisation for Economic Cooperation and Development (OECD), was adapted for this research. The results obtained show that, in general, the surveyed companies present low ICT readiness and intensity, with the exception of service companies and microenterprises. Furthermore, there is no evidence of a clear perceived positive ICT impact on the exports taking into account all companies, neither considering their sector or size. Nevertheless, large companies perceive a positive effect, which is consistent with a sustained increase in their export value. Based on the previous results, we discuss factors that might influence the adoption and use of ICT in the export companies and present recommendations to increase its use. In addition, suggestions for further research are presented.
